KUTZTOWN, Pa. – The Lock Haven University men's basketball team (6-12, 4-10 PSAC) dropped a tough Pennsylvania State Athletic Conference (PSAC) East road game at perennial PSAC power Kutztown University (14-3, 10-3 PSAC) 91-75.
The Bald Eagles and The Golden Bears battled early and often as the teams played a very physical game. Kutztown was able to jump out to an 22-11 early lead, but LHU used a 8-2 run to cut the deficit to 24-19 midway through the first half. KU was then able to start a big run and take a 50-32 lead at halftime.
In the second half, Lock Haven was able to cut the Kutztown lead down to 10, but they couldn't quite complete the comeback as The Golden Bears were able to knock down some tough and timely shots to secure the win.
The Bald Eagle offense was led by
Amir Hinton (Philadelphia/Abington) as he led LHU with 19 points to go along with five rebounds and four assists.
Ra'eese Hunt (Upper Marlboro, Md./Riverdale Baptist) and
Tarojae Brake (Coatesville, Pa./Octorara) both played well on the offensive end as well. Hunt was able to score 18 points to go along with six rebounds. Brake scored 15 points to go along with five assists and two blocks.
Jesse McPherson (Philadelphia, Archbishop Carroll) was solid for the Bald Eagles, totaling five points to go along with a career-high 11 rebounds and a blocked shot.
Jihad Barnes (Philadelphia/Philadelphia Electric Charter) finished with four points, four rebounds and five assists.
